Output ec64525a0c33e69f8a7fb3767daea6474b7bf35ebcced38d93623b2bbe774600:1

value
4143978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36a85a7d34b125f78714d74e7abd6ddb859a1296 OP_EQUAL
address
36g26Jku12RbK7kszc9c4DKvgBiDuPbhJd
transaction
ec64525a0c33e69f8a7fb3767daea6474b7bf35ebcced38d93623b2bbe774600
spent
true